Everything You Need For the Perfect Work From Home Setup
The shift towards remote and hybrid work models in the 2020s has highlighted the importance of a dedicated and well-equipped home office space. This guide provides a comprehensive list of essential products to create an ideal work-from-home setup, focusing on comfort, efficiency, and aesthetics. It covers various categories, including laptops, desks, chairs, monitors, keyboards, mice, mousepads, docking stations, webcams, external storage, and printers.
For laptops, the 13-inch MacBook Air is recommended for most Apple users due to its speed, battery life, and affordability. For more intensive tasks like video editing, a PC such as the Asus Zenbook S 16 is suggested, offering an OLED touchscreen and comparable battery life to MacBooks. Desks are evaluated for elegance and flexibility, with the Herman Miller Jarvis bamboo desk praised for its customizability and adjustable height. The Artifox desk is also highlighted for its modular design, cable management, and integrated features for phones, tablets, and headphones.
Ergonomic chairs are deemed crucial for productivity and well-being during long working hours. The Herman Miller Aeron Chair is presented as a premium investment for its superior ergonomics, while the Branch Ergonomic Chair offers a more affordable yet durable alternative. Regarding monitors, a 34-inch ultrawide display, like the Samsung ViewFinity QHD Monitor, is recommended for enhanced organization and reduced eye strain. The curved Dell monitor is also mentioned for its multi-screen functionality and charging capabilities.
Mechanical keyboards from Keychron are favored for their affordability, reliability, and customization options, suitable for both typing and gaming. For mice, Logitech's G Lightspeed mouse is recommended for its simplicity and efficiency, with the Logitech Lift Vertical Ergonomic Mouse offered as an ergonomic alternative. Mousepads, often overlooked, are also discussed, with the SteelSeries QcK Performance L-Balance suggested for basic use and the Logitech G Powerplay wireless charging mousepad for its convenience. A docking station or USB hub, like the Baseus 10-in-1 Docking Station, is considered essential for connecting multiple peripherals to modern laptops with limited ports.
Webcams, such as the Logitech Brio 505, are highlighted for improving video call quality beyond standard laptop cameras. External SSDs, like the Samsung T9 Portable SSD 2TB, are presented as valuable additions for file storage and portability, though not strictly essential. Finally, printers, specifically the HP OfficeJet Pro, are included for those who require physical documents, acknowledging the setup and maintenance challenges but emphasizing the benefits over external printing services.
